WebThe Children's Health Insurance Program (CHIP) provides comprehensive benefits to children. States have flexibility to design their own program within federal guidelines, so benefits vary by state and by the type of CHIP program. States may choose between a Medicaid expansion program, a separate CHIP, or a combination of both types of programs.
